6338021 Scenes in England, Regency era by English School, (18th century); (add.info.: Scenes in England, Regency era. English sailor setting out from home for the merchant navy 1, view of ships on the Thames in London 2, view of John o Groats in Scotland 3. Handcoloured copperplate engraving from Rev. Isaac Taylors Scenes in Europe, for the Amusement and Instruction of Little Tarry-at-Home Travelers, John Harris, London, 1819.); © Florilegius

This print takes us back in time to the Regency era in England, offering a glimpse into the lives and adventures of its people. The image showcases three distinct scenes that beautifully capture the essence of this historical period. In the first scene, we witness an English sailor bidding farewell to his loved ones as he embarks on a new journey with the merchant navy. His brave spirit and sense of adventure are palpable, reminding us of the courage required for such endeavors during this time. The second scene transports us to London's bustling Thames River, where majestic ships gracefully sail along its waters. This view provides a fascinating insight into the maritime industry that played a vital role in shaping England's economy and global influence. Lastly, we are treated to a breathtaking sight of John o Groats in Scotland. The rugged beauty of this coastal landscape is awe-inspiring, evoking feelings of wanderlust and curiosity about distant lands waiting to be explored. Handcoloured with meticulous attention to detail, this copperplate engraving from Rev. Isaac Taylor's "Scenes in Europe" serves not only as an artistic masterpiece but also as an educational tool for young travelers at home. It offers valuable insights into history, costume, and geography while igniting imaginations and fostering a thirst for knowledge.
